HOUSTON, Texas (Reuters) -- Hunters soon may be able to sit at their computers and blast away at animals on a Texas ranch via the Internet, a prospect that has state wildlife officials up in arms.

The Web site already offers target practice with a .22 caliber rifle and could soon let hunters shoot at deer, antelope and wild pigs, site creator John Underwood said on Tuesday.

Texas officials are not quite sure what to make of Underwood's Web site, but may tweak existing laws to make sure Internet hunting does not get out of hand.

Remore assassinations already exist. The U.S. assassinated some Al Qaida guys in Yemen using a missle fired at a car from a remote controlled drone aircraft sometime last year. It was all over the news. Not quite the same as doing it from your lazy boy, but remote none-the-less.
